Isododecane

Isododecane is a lightweight, fast-drying emollient and solvent commonly used in UK beauty products such as mascaras, foundations, lipsticks and primers. It gives formulas a silky, non-greasy feel and helps them spread easily while improving wear time. Shoppers often see it in long-wear and waterproof cosmetics.

How it works in skincare

In cosmetics and skincare Isododecane acts as a volatile silicone alternative, evaporating quickly after application to leave behind a smooth, breathable film. It improves the spreadability of pigments and waxes, prevents settling in liquid formulas, and enhances the overall texture so products feel weightless on skin or lips while boosting their staying power.

Key benefits

  • Provides a silky, non-greasy finish
  • Improves spreadability and even application
  • Helps extend wear time of makeup
  • Gives a smooth, soft after-feel
  • Reduces tackiness in formulas
  • Enhances waterproof properties

Where it comes from

Isododecane is a branched-chain hydrocarbon (alkane) primarily derived from petroleum through fractional distillation and refining processes.
